Index: tools/metrics/histograms/histograms.xml |
diff --git a/tools/metrics/histograms/histograms.xml b/tools/metrics/histograms/histograms.xml |
index 59a63b0595fc0479fbdaa944dbec62db41cc9e68..cd20cca869104ed2085f786fc9982f2dec8a0c0a 100644 |
--- a/tools/metrics/histograms/histograms.xml |
+++ b/tools/metrics/histograms/histograms.xml |
@@ -36148,74 +36148,12 @@ Therefore, the affected-histogram name has to have at least one dot in it. |
</summary> |
</histogram> |
-<histogram name="Stability.ExitFunnel.BackgroundOff" units="milliseconds"> |
+<histogram name="Stability.ExitFunnel" units="milliseconds"> |
<ow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.BackgroundOn"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.BrowserExit"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.EndSession"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.ES_CloseApp"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.ES_Critical"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.ES_Logoff"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.ES_Other"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.KillProcess"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.LastWindowClose"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.SessionEnding"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.TraybarExit"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.WatcherLogoff"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
-</histogram> |
- |
-<histogram name="Stability.ExitFunnel.WM_ENDSESSION" units="milliseconds"> |
- <owner>siggi@chromium.org</owner> |
- <summary>Temporary instrumentation. See http://crbug.com/412384.</summary> |
+ <summary> |
+ Temporary instrumentation to record the Windows browser's exit path. See |
+ http://crbug.com/412384. |
+ </summary> |
</histogram> |
<histogram name="Stars.Goog_Related" units="percent"> |
@@ -59923,6 +59861,25 @@ To add a new entry, add it with any value and run test to compute valid value. |
<affected-histogram name="Media.EME.Widevine"/> |
</histogram_suffixes> |
+<histogram_suffixes name="ExitFunnels" separator="."> |
+ <suffix name="BackgroundOff"/> |
+ <suffix name="BackgroundOn"/> |
+ <suffix name="BrowserExit"/> |
+ <suffix name="EndSession"/> |
+ <suffix name="ES_CloseApp"/> |
+ <suffix name="ES_Critical"/> |
+ <suffix name="ES_Logoff"/> |
+ <suffix name="ES_Other"/> |
+ <suffix name="KillProcess"/> |
+ <suffix name="LastWindowClose"/> |
+ <suffix name="SessionEnding"/> |
+ <suffix name="TraybarEndSession"/> |
+ <suffix name="TraybarExit"/> |
+ <suffix name="WatcherLogoff"/> |
+ <suffix name="WM_ENDSESSION"/> |
+ <affected-histogram name="Stability.ExitFunnel"/> |
+</histogram_suffixes> |
+ |
<histogram_suffixes name="ExternalExtensionEvent" separator=""> |
<suffix name="NonWebstore" |
label="sideloaded extensions that don't update from the webstore"/> |